Through free home visits the Healthy Families and Healthy Start Programs promote parenting, enhance child health and development and encourage bonding and family relationships.
If you are expecting a baby and you live in Poughkeepsie, Hyde Park, Beacon, Ellenville, or Kingston, please contact us. Referral to our program is easy and all our services are free! We’ll set up a meeting for one of our awesome team to come out to your home and meet with you! At this meeting we will talk about what is going on in your family’s life and provide resources that you may not have known about!
Some examples of information we can provide families with are:
- How to manage labor, creating a birth plan
- Newborn and infant care
- How children grow and learn
- How to play with your baby to encourage learning
- Breastfeeding information and support

STATEMENT OF PURPOSE:
The mission of the Dutchess County Healthy Families (DCHF) and Ulster County Healthy Start (UCHS) programs are to support and serve pregnant and parenting families through activities and education focused on:
- Supporting bonding and attachment
- Promoting optimal health, development, and safety
- Decreasing stressors and improving coping skills
- Increasing self-sufficiency
